Summary
Amend The South Carolina Code Of Laws By Adding Section 59-1-395 So As To Provide Public School District Employees Who Hold Elected Public Office Are Entitled To The Equivalent Of Five Paid Workdays During Each School Year To Attend Meetings Or Training Related To Their Office, And To Provide Documentation Requirements.
